Morning Bag Skate: Blackhawks rout Blue Jackets 5-1 as Saad, Toews shine

The Blackhawks improved to 2-0-0 in their youthful season on Saturday night, as they soundly defeated the Columbus Blue Jackets 5-1. Patrick Kane, Brandon Saad, and Jonathan Toews each contributed a goal and an assist in the victory. Corey Crawford made 32 saves and let in a lone Columbus goal during the second period.

Chicago’s next game is slated for Monday at six p.m. against the Maple Leafs in Toronto.
